Why does PCguard Anti-Spyware keep detecting spyware when I have Kazaa installed?

Kazaa installs software on your computer than is classed as spyware by some security programs. If you don’t want spyware on your computer, you have to uninstall Kazaa or add Kazaa to the trusted programs list. To move spyware to the trusted programs list: In the Quarantine page, select the spyware that you want to keep. Click ‘Restore’. The selected spyware will be moved to the trusted programs list and will be included in the next spyware scan.
